Beverly B. Potter, 84, of Cooperstown, went home to be with her Lord and Savior, Jesus Christ, on December 29, 2019 at Sugar Creek Station in Franklin.Born January 12, 1935 in Cooperstown, Beverly was the daughter of the late Emery Q. and Edna Mae (Couch) Boughner. She was married to the love of her life, Howard M. Potter, on January 22, 1971; he preceded her in death on July 9, 2015.For a significant portion of her life, Beverly worked as a Financial Officer in the Trust Department of Exchange Bank. When she wasn't working, Beverly spent most of her time with her beloved family or tending her gardens at home. With a love of traveling, she cherished the time she spent with her husband in their motor home, as they traveled to different portions of the United States and Canada.Left to cherish her memory is her step-son, Jeffrey W.
